How Many Websites Does AWS Host? An In-Depth Analysis

In the ever-expanding realm of web hosting, Amazon Web Services (AWS) stands out as a colossal player. With its robust infrastructure and global reach, AWS supports an extensive array of websites. According to the latest data from BuiltWith, AWS hosts approximately 49,963,267 live websites. This figure underscores the significant role AWS plays in the digital landscape, serving as a foundational platform for countless online entities.

Understanding AWS’s Web Hosting Solutions

AWS provides a comprehensive range of web hosting services, each designed to meet specific requirements. Here’s a closer look at some of its key offerings:

  • Amazon EC2 (Elastic Compute Cloud): This service allows users to run virtual servers in the cloud, providing scalable compute capacity. Businesses use EC2 for various purposes, including web hosting, due to its flexibility and reliability.
  • Amazon S3 (Simple Storage Service): S3 is used for storing and retrieving any amount of data, such as website content, media files, and backups. Its durability and availability make it a popular choice for website data storage.
  • Amazon RDS (Relational Database Service): RDS provides a managed relational database service, essential for websites requiring database support. It simplifies database management tasks and enhances performance.
  • AWS Lambda: This service allows developers to run code without provisioning or managing servers, facilitating the development of serverless applications that can handle varying workloads efficiently.
  • Amazon CloudFront: As a content delivery network (CDN), CloudFront accelerates the delivery of web content by distributing it across multiple edge locations worldwide, thus improving website load times and performance.

The Scale and Scope of AWS’s Web Hosting Reach

AWS’s hosting infrastructure spans multiple geographic regions and availability zones, ensuring high availability and reliability. Each region consists of multiple availability zones, which are physically separated locations within the region. This architecture enhances fault tolerance and disaster recovery, crucial for maintaining the uptime of websites hosted on AWS.

AWS’s Global Infrastructure

  • Regions: AWS operates in numerous regions globally, each comprising several availability zones. This extensive network allows AWS to offer low-latency access and redundancy for websites.
  • Availability Zones: Each region has multiple availability zones, providing isolated environments to protect against failures. This setup ensures that websites hosted on AWS remain accessible even in the event of an issue in one availability zone.
  • Edge Locations: AWS’s content delivery network, CloudFront, uses edge locations to cache content closer to end users. This global network of edge locations improves the speed and reliability of content delivery for websites.

Case Studies: Noteworthy Websites Hosted on AWS

Several high-profile websites and services rely on AWS for their hosting needs. These case studies illustrate AWS’s capability to handle diverse and demanding web hosting requirements:

  • Netflix: As a leading streaming service, Netflix utilizes AWS to handle its massive scale of operations, including video streaming and data processing. AWS’s infrastructure supports Netflix’s global user base and high traffic volumes.
  • Airbnb: Airbnb leverages AWS to manage its online marketplace and handle booking transactions. The scalability and flexibility of AWS’s services enable Airbnb to accommodate fluctuating traffic and operational demands.
  • Twitch: Twitch, a popular live-streaming platform for gamers, depends on AWS for its streaming services and infrastructure. AWS’s reliable performance and scalability support Twitch’s large and active user base.
